A chiminea can bring warmth and a crackling fire to your backyard. Consider your space and the way you plan to use it when shopping for an achiminea. If you intend to grill, select one with grill grates and allows you to move logs with ease. Also, make sure that you can be comfortable near the fire, without breathing in smoke. In addition to assessing your environment and whether you will need to store the chiminea in freezing temperatures, you should choose the material you would like the chiminea to be made out of. Clay models tend to be traditional and less expensive but can break easily or shatter during a freeze. Steel chimineas can rust when not properly coated with weatherproof finish. Cast iron is heavy and requires a lot of maintenance but it will last for a long time, developing an attractive patina over time. In the end casting aluminum is a costlier alternative but is also durable and is designed to disperse heat evenly.

In contrast to fire pits, which do not emit smoke and leave your clothes smelling like wood, chimineas come with chimneys that channel away ash and smoke. These portable outdoor heat sources are made from clay, steel, and cast iron chiminea iron in a broad variety of styles. Some are updated versions of traditional clay chimineas whereas others are designed with an aged and rustic appearance that develops a beautiful patina with time. Most chimineas feature chimneys and fire bowls to direct smoke up and a screen or door to protect people and pets from falling embers. Certain chimineas come with additional features, such as log storage trays or 360-degree screens that allow people to view the flames from different angles.
